The report of the 19 th National Congress of the Communist Party of China pointed out that “we must strengthen the government’s credibility and execution,and build a service-oriented government that satisfies the people.”Improving and improving the political trust of the people is the lubricant of good governance and an important issue that the party and the state must attach importance to.The group of migrant workers in our country occupies a significant proportion of the total population,so the political trust level of migrant workers will affect or even fluctuate the overall trust level of the country.And social mobility is not only related to a person’s position in society and the amount of resources occupied,but also significantly affects a person’s emotional cognition and value attitude.This includes attitudes,emotions,and values toward politics.Therefore,studying the influence of migrant workers’ social mobility on political trust has strong theoretical and practical significance.From the perspective of the influence of social mobility on political trust,this paper examines the influence of mobility motivation,realistic intra generational mobility,expected intra generational mobility and intergenerational mobility on all dimensions of political trust.Based on the data analysis of 615 migrant workers in Z Province,it is found that: 1.The overall political trust of migrant workers is acceptable,but there are also weak differences among different dimensions;2.The overall preference of migrant workers’ social mobility is upward social mobility;3.Urban pull factor,realistic upward generation mobility,expected downward generation mobility and intergenerational downward mobility has an impact on political trust.Based on the empirical analysis,this paper discusses the following aspects: first,whether the current situation of political trust of migrant workers falls into the Tacitus trap? According to the existing data analysis,it is found that although the dimensions of political trust are generally at the upper level of medium level,the institutional trust and the trust of members are slightly lower than that of the institutional trust.Therefore,the degree of political trust should be further enhanced to avoid falling into the Tacitus trap.Second,what is the current situation of migrant workers’ social mobility? Is there a phenomenon of "solidifying" of stratum? The research finds that the proportion of horizontal and downward mobility of migrant workers is relatively small,and the main body of social flow is still upward flow,so there is no "solidifying" phenomenon of stratum.Third,how does social mobility affect political trust? Through analysis,it is found that the "complex person" with both characteristics has an impact on political trust.Therefore,we can improve the social and economic status of the group and reduce the cognitive deviation of mobility,and then increase their political trust by providing migrant workers with the opportunity to move up,reducing their "relative deprivation" and actively promoting their political trust.
